- Virtual Game Card Guide - Nintendo Support
Information The digital games and DLC you purchase through Nintendo eShop are treated as virtual game cards on your console This allows you to digitally load and eject your virtual game cards like you would a physical game card—for example, if you own a Nintendo Switch 2 and a Nintendo Switch console, you can eject a virtual game card from one console and then load it on the second console
- How to Redeem a Nintendo eShop Download Code Online
Enter your 16-digit download code and then select Next Re-enter your Nintendo Account password when prompted, then select Redeem to complete the process A confirmation e-mail will also be sent to the e-mail address registered to your Nintendo Account once this process is completed
